What you can expect to work on…

The Electrical Technician supports the safe, reliable operation of accelerator and RF systems by performing preventive ma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air of high‑voltage and pulsed power equipment. This role is responsible for maintaining and calibrating electrical and RF subsystems, diagnosing complex electrical faults, and supporting installation, commissioning, and beam operations.

  • Performs routine preventive maintenance, inspection, and calibration of high‑voltage power supplies, pulsed modulators, tetrodes, waveguide systems, and RF distribution components
  • Troubleshoots and repairs electrical faults in the accelerator systems including high‑voltage circuits including breakers; pulsed power systems; magnet power supplies; electron gun and beam transport electronics; and cooling and vacuum system interlocks
  • Conducts visual and electrical testing of RF components (wave guides, circulators, loads, windows) for signs of arcing, vacuum leaks, or degradation
  • Supports installation, commissioning, and acceptance testing of new or upgraded electrical/RF subsystems
  • Assists in beam tuning and conditioning activities by monitoring electrical parameters and responding to interlock trips or faults
